For those who don't speak NYFD jargon here are a few pointers-
10-45 Code 1 = DOA
CFRD Engines = Firefighters that are on the CFRD program -- which stands for Certified
First Responders -- they are heavily trained in the first instance. They respond to calls
for asthma attacks, serious burns, choking, obviously cardiac arrest. As well as other
types of calls. NYFD has Fire Engines dedicated to this program.
Fieldcom = A mobile truck unit dispatched to the scene of major fires to coordinate the
communications effort.
Highway one car = An elite NYPD Highway Patrol Unit- From the Bronx. NYPD Highway Patrol
provides Hospital escorts for injured Firemen and Police officers in addition to normal
patrol functions.
House line stretched = A Fire Hose off of the buildings internal standpipe system.
OV = Outside vent is the firefighter responsible for venting the building.
"Seven Alpha to Seven." = Battalion Seven's Aide Calling Battalion 7's Chief.
TAC 1 = Tactical Service Unit # 1 (Boss)
TAC 1 Alpha = Tactical Service Unit # 1 Aide
